WebEnsure your surface is clean (use soap and water, then let it air dry) and cured before painting, and remove any wallpaper. If there are any gaps or cracks in the wall, you’ll want to repair them before proceeding. You may also choose to sand out rough spots in the walls (wear a respirator). WebCombine the TSP and hot water in a bowl or bucket, and use a rag or sponge to wipe down the walls, trim, and baseboards. Be sure to ring the rag out well so there’s not too much liquid running down your walls. After cleaning, rinse the areas using a clean rag and water. Web8 Jul 2024 · 5 Quick Painting Tips Everyone Should Know 01 of 07 Patch Any Holes Getty Images A fresh coat of paint can magnify even tiny holes on an unpainted wall. To avoid regret down the line, take the time to patch any holes now. Once the spackle is dry, sand it lightly until the surface is smooth. WebSteps for Repairing Plaster Walls Start the project by cleaning up the crack with the utility knife. Look for compound, paint flakes, and other debris in the crack and scrape it out. Using the putty knife, apply a thin coat of joint compound to the crack. Start at the top of the crack and drag the compound down, pushing it into the crack as you go.

Web3 Apr 2024 · Step 4: Patch over the cracks. With a taping knife, patch the cracks with a thin layer of drywall mud. Make sure the edges of the patches are thin so it's easy to sand when it dries.
